Manufacturing Renaissance: US solar manufacturing capacity has grown 190% year-over-year in 2024, reaching over 51 GW annually—enough to meet nearly all domestic demand while creating over 33,000 manufacturing jobs across the country. The position of the sun in the sky can be plotted using two angles, azimuth and zenith and the angle of the solar panel orientation relies upon these two values.
